An experimental approach to heat transfer enhancement in heat exchanger tubes using hyperbolic-cut twisted tape inserts: IoT and biomedical insights
摘要
This study investigates the Nusselt number (Nu), friction factor (f), and thermohydraulic performance (η) in a heat exchanger tube (HET) equipped with hyperbolic cut twisted tapes (HCTTs). This research investigates the effects of hyperbolic-cut and cut-width ratio configurations under turbulent flow conditions.
